Situated in a quiet and idyllic countryside location with glorious views across the fields, Beech Corner provides the ideal spot to relax and unwind. This open plan first floor property is furnished and finished to a high quality throughout and offers a real slice of luxury for any couples retreat. From the bedroom you enjoy views out across the fields, the perfect excuse to enjoy your morning coffee in bed. Beech Corner also benefits from its own private garden, again with magnificent countryside views. Just moments from the town of Reepham where you can enjoy the shops, pubs and the Marriott’s Way, ideal for walking or cycling. Pub: 2 miles Shop: 2 miles.

The village of Booton is situated just two miles from the market town of Reepham. The town itself has been designated a conservation area and is surrounded by beautiful countryside. Impressive Georgian properties line the square and the town is unique in once having had three churches in one churchyard. Booton is an ideal area for walking and cycling, with the Marriott's Way just a short distance away on the outskirts of Reepham. The beautiful North Norfolk Coast, the renowned Broads and the fine city of Norwich are all just a short drive away. There are shops, pubs which serve food and cafes in the town, with fishing, golf and horse riding available locally.
